For couples contemplating divorce, its important to know the difference between separation and abandonment. Abandonment can be grounds for divorce if your case meets two different requirements: Your spouse left with the intention to abandon you Your spouse stayed away for at least a year This can be challenging to prove. If your spouse is only absent for 6 months, then that is not enough, even if your spouse claimed they weren't coming back. Likewise, it is not considered abandonment when a spouse leaves the marital home after an argument but returns home after days or weeks. If someone is in a dangerous situation and they choose to leave and cease cohabitation for their own safety, they are not "abandoning" the marriage.
